9 Meters Biopharma, Inc. focuses on developing innovative therapies for rare diseases, particularly in gastrointestinal disorders. Its lead product candidate, NM-002, targets short bowel syndrome, a condition affecting patients post-surgery, which presents a unique market opportunity due to limited competition in this niche. The company operates primarily in the United States, leveraging its specialized knowledge in biopharmaceutical development.
9 Meters Biopharma aims to generate revenue through the commercialization of its lead product and potential partnerships with larger pharmaceutical companies. Its competitive advantage lies in its focus on rare diseases, which often face less competition and can command higher prices due to the specialized nature of the treatments.
